Robinson Cano
Robinson Jose Cano
All-Star Player
Bats: Left , Throws: Right
Height: 6' 0" , Weight: 170 lb.

Born: October 22, 1982 in San Pedro de Macoris, D.R.
High School: San Pedro de Marcoris (San Pedro de Marcoris, DO)
Signed
by the New York Yankees as an amateur free agent in 2001. (All Transactions)
Debut: May 3, 2005
Relatives: Son of Jose Cano
